HITAG proximity evaluation kit
FEATURES The evaluation kit comprises the following components: * Proximity read and write device with integrated antenna * DC power supply cable * RS232 interface cable * HITAG transponders * CD-ROM with: - Demonstration software - User manual. APPLICATIONS * Easy integration and application of HITAG proximity readers. GENERAL DESCRIPTION HITAG(1) is the name of one of the universal and powerful product lines of our 125 kHz family. The HITAG product family is used both in the proximity area (operating range up to approximately 200 mm) and in the long range area (operating range up to approximately 1000 mm).
(1) HITAG - is a trademark of Philips Semiconductors Gratkorn GmbH.
HTEV400
Developing our HITAG products, utmost consideration was given to security and reliability. The use of cryptography guarantees highest data security. The central part of every HITAG read and write device is the HITAG core module, which ensures full compatibility for every HITAG read and write device. To give you the possibility for an easy and quick start with our HITAG products we offer a HITAG proximity evaluation kit. Easy application certainly is an important factor in making the proximity evaluation kit suitable for evaluation purposes. You will be able to present your ideas and demonstrate the performance of your system with the help of the HITAG evaluation kit. The HTEV400 supports both HITAG 1 and HITAG 2 products. However, the HTEV400 does NOT support the anticollision feature of HITAG 1.

Software start-up SYSTEM REQUIREMENTS In order to use the RFIDDEMO software the following system requirements must be satisfied: * IBM-PC or compatible (minimum 286 processor) * 640 kbyte RAM * Serial interface. INSTALLATION 1. Create a new directory on your PC for the demo-files e.g. C:\RFIDDEMO 2. Copy all the files from the CD-ROM into the new directory. STARTING THE DEMO-PROGRAM We strongly recommend to carefully read the user manual "RFIDDEMO HITAG evaluation software" before starting the demo system. Inconsiderate use of individual menu options may result in unwanted irreversible changes in access rights. Start your demo-program by typing the command RFIDDEMO.EXE. DEFINITIONS Short-form specification The data in a short-form specification is extracted from a full data sheet with the same type number and title. For detailed information see the relevant data sheet or data handbook. Limiting values definition Limiting values given are in accordance with the Absolute Maximum Rating System (IEC 60134). Stress above one or more of the limiting values may cause permanent damage to the device. These are stress ratings only and operation of the device at these or at any other conditions above those given in the Characteristics sections of the specification is not implied. Exposure to limiting values for extended periods may affect device reliability.
